When I was at Gormanston Summer School in 2006, Micheal MacGiollaCoda put a vile of queen pheromone on the end of a fishing pole and I think he knew where the congregation might be and sure enough the buzzing started followed by dark dots in the sky. It was a very open area. I will never forget this.
Where I live now, I have never caught a swarm. I have been here 4 years. I have done google earth and cannot see any hives within 2 miles. Across the street to the east is 800+ acres of forest and wetlands. I would have hoped that there were feral bees about, but no. I have not had any of my own swarms cast, so I'm not even populating the forest!
